Pros of Disclosing Your Autism to Your Employer

Opening up about your autism can unlock doors you didn't know existed. Here's why many choose transparency:

  • Access to Accommodations: Under the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A), employers must provide reasonable accommodations like flexible hours, quiet spaces, or clear communication tools. Recent data shows accommodated autistic employees report 20-30% higher job satisfaction.
  • Reduced Stress and Burnout ✅: Masking autistic traits drains energy. Disclosure allows authenticity, boosting focus and performance.
  • Building Trust: Honest communication fosters stronger manager relationships, leading to mentorship and promotions.
  • Legal Protection: Disclosure creates a record, safeguarding against unfair treatment.

Cons and Risks of Disclosing Autism at Work

No decision is risk-free. Consider these potential downsides:

  • Stigma and Bias ❌: Despite progress, some managers harbor misconceptions, leading to overlooked opportunities.
  • Privacy Loss: Information might spread informally, altering colleague dynamics.
  • Irreversible Choice: Once disclosed, retracting is tough.
  • Variable Employer Response: Not all companies are supportive, especially smaller ones without HR expertise.

Legal Rights: What Does the Law Say About Autism Disclosure?

The ADA classifies autism as a disability, mandating equal employment opportunities for qualified individuals. Key points from the newest U.S.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) guidance:

  • You don't have to disclose unless requesting accommodations.
  • Employers can't discriminate or retaliate.
  • Interactive Process: Post-disclosure, collaborate on solutions without revealing unnecessary medical details.

When Is the Best Time to Disclose Your Autism?

Timing matters. Avoid knee-jerk reactions—strategize:

  1. Pre-Interview: Rarely ideal; focus on skills first.
  2. During Onboarding: If accommodations are needed early.
  3. After Performance Proof: Build credibility, then disclose during reviews.
  4. In Crisis: Struggling? Disclose promptly for support.

Newest workplace autism studies recommend waiting 3-6 months to demonstrate value, reducing bias risks.

How to Disclose Autism Professionally: Step-by-Step

Prepare like a pro:

  1. Research Your Company: Review diversity policies.
  2. Script It: "I have autism, which affects [specifics]. With [accommodation], I excel at [strengths]."
  3. Choose the Right Person: HR or direct supervisor in a private meeting.
  4. Document Everything: Email follow-up.
  5. Prepare Alternatives: If denied, know escalation paths.

Practice boosts confidence. Role-play with a trusted ally for authenticity.

Alternatives If You Choose Not to Disclose

Not ready? Self-manage effectively:

  • Use apps for task organization.
  • Seek peer networks like online autism forums.
  • Build informal supports without labels.

Hybrid approaches—disclosing partially—work for some.
